Accessibility Statement for Volvo Cars App

Volvo Cars is dedicated to making Volvo Cars iOS and Android Apps accessible in accordance with the Act on the Accessibility (Directive (EU) 2019/882) of Certain Products and Services.

This statement concerns Volvo App iOS and Android version 5.58 published on 01.07.2025

Status

The iOS and Android Apps are partially compliant with the Act on the Accessibility of Certain Products and Services due to the non-compliances described below. All issues are being handled and will be solved as soon as possible.

Non-Accessible Content

HTML

The reading order of the content is logical

The reading order of the content is not logical on some screens and does not reflect the visual order.

Navigation and Links

The interface can be controlled by keyboard on both desktop and mobile

When navigating with an external keyboard, the interface works well in most places, except in the chat. When focus is on the input field one cannot move out of the field. This means it is not possible to send a message. The only available action is to return to the previous view.

Focus is clearly displayed when users navigate with the keyboard

When users navigate with the keyboard it must be visually clear where the focus is. On some screens certain elements are not being visually highlighted when they receive keyboard focus.

Features can be used without dragging motions

There are functions where the user must be able to perform a dragging gesture. In some parts on iOS, the user needs to hold down a finger and drag left or right to adjust the setting.

The target of links is clearly stated in context

There are several clickable elements that takes the user out of the App to a web browser or web view but are not presented as links.

Non-text Content

Text Alternatives (Alt Text)

Some charts and graphs don’t have a text alternative that serves the equivalent purpose.

Purposeful Descriptions

Some graphs don’t have a complementary text alternative that convey the main message of the graph to be equally informative as viewing the graph itself.

Colors & Presentation

Visual indication of clickable objects and adjacent colors have a contrast of, at least, 3.0:1

There are form objects and other clickable elements that do not meet the required contrast ratio of 3.0:1. This mainly applies to the frames around certain input fields and switch buttons, where the contrast with the background color is too low.

Understandability is not dependent on the user’s ability to perceive color

In some areas the only indicator that something is a clickable link is with a certain color and not supplemented with at least one additional way of conveying the information, such as an icon, underline or similar.

Structure & Formatting

Text that visually function as a heading is coded as a heading

Some visual headings is missing the heading markup.

The heading structure is logical and represents the hierarchy of the content

Some headings are not marked with the correct level to follow a logical hierarchy making it hard for screen readers to follow a logical order.

Paragraphs are created correctly using the p element

Some views contain text that is visually divided into smaller sections, but in the code, it is treated as one large block, making it difficult to navigate between them.

Images

Equivalent text descriptions are present for all meaningful graphical elements on the website

In some places descriptions for certain images are incorrect.

Forms

Forms are coded correctly with form elements

Some form elements are not correctly implemented and cannot be selected.

How We Tested Accessibility

The evaluation was conducted by independent experts from Funka. The website was assessed using manual testing and assistive technologies against WCAG 2.2, levels A and AA.

Testing period: 2025-05-26 to 2025-06-19
